Build Quality - The housings of the customs are made probably by Acrylic. It is very sturdy and I would not expect any scratches any time soon. I would say that the build quality is excellent. There is not a single bubble anywhere or a scratch. It fitted when they arrived. The seal is perfect and doesn’t break. It's my first pair of customs so I had to get used to it - comfortable but feels different. However, customs differ from person to person so your experience may differ. It fits snugly and I don't have to go for a refit.

Sound Quality
Setup: Stage 93's Reshell + 2 Driver Customs, UE11 Wire. NO AMP.
Connected to my laptop.

Test Tracks

"Misery" by Maroon Five from the album "Hands All Over"
This track was handled very well. The cymbals, snares and bass drums were extremely clear. I would say this track focused a lot on the guitar, and my Stage 93 customs handled it really well.

"Strong Baby" by Big Bang from the album "Remember"
It seems like I'm at a live concert, a few rows away. The singer's voice is very clear, the background is handled well. However, gradually as the song progresses, the background seems to be louder than the vocals. This song uses a lot of special effects and I would say it's handled really, really well.

"Shi Ren" by Zhang Zhi Cheng from the album "saveZ"
This song was probably the best sounding one. Instrument separation was perfect. The vocals really stood out on this one; his voice was really clear and the piano riff in the background fitted perfectly. Drums were not overwhelming. This was probably my best song experience.

"Majimak Insa Remix" by Big Bang from the album "Remember"
This is another one of my favourite songs. It is a mix of special effects with rap and vocals. I gotta say this blew my mind. It was like reliving the Korean Pop Night concert back last year. The sounds and effects were amazing. Rap was especially clear compared to vocals.

"Kimi no Shiranai Monogatari" by supercell from the album "Kimi no Shiranai Monogatari"
This song is my favourite and listening via the Stage 93 customs blew me away. The highs were handled really well. I especially liked how the high hats sounded. The singer's voice was really smooth and soothing. The piano again, was extremely clear, like in a live concert. The electric guitar and bass guitar was very pleasant sounding - especially when plucking. I could not find any fault with this song.

Conclusion
Overall, I feel that the reshelled Stage 93 customs are a excellent pair of earphones. I will probably stick to this for a long, long time. If it sounds great unamped, I look forward to its sound amped, and upgraded to Twag :)

Thought TF 10 pro drivers are 2 low and 1 high..? Normally add drivers to TF10 pro normally just 1 mid.. You added 1 mid 1 high.. Hmmm.. Stage 93 can offer to make it 5 drivers arr..?

Yes tf10p stock is 2 low(2 native low and mid comes from the lows) 1 high

1 low 1 mid 1 high is shure 530/535

Shure's drivers set up clearly shows that it's built to sound more to clarity side while tf10p is expectably suppose to have more bass and lesser clarity than it's shure triple driver counter part.
